logo

Output 43373752a703d472e9b93551a334f0a940aab2136b267e4720ccfe0379832329:119

value
39857992
script pubkey
OP_0 OP_PUSHBYTES_20 650ac81daf51a59dc87832349283e17d76c7aa0b
address
bc1qv59vs8d02xjemjrcxg6f9qlp04mv02st0klg3e
transaction
43373752a703d472e9b93551a334f0a940aab2136b267e4720ccfe0379832329